Daughter of the NHL royalty, Wayne Gretzky, Paulina Gretzky has been in the limelight since childhood. After her marriage to the golf prodigy, Dustin Johnson, Paulina found herself in the spotlight even more. As an actress and a model herself, Gretzky has made a name of her own in the entertainment industry. Recently, in a new magazine cover, she opened up about the pregnancy struggles she faced and the “toll” it took on her.

The Kind Magazine released its October issue this month. And Paulina Gretzky’s stunning face appears on the cover. The beautiful model appeared as stunning as ever at the Balm beach. This month’s fall issue of the magazine is all about health and wellness. Paulina, expressing how she finds balance as a “supermodel mother,” also opened up about the challenges she experienced during her pregnancy.

Talking to the magazine, Paulina said, “Pregnancy was tough and I’m not going to lie. Adjusting to my new body took a toll.” But that was not all. Sharing about the need to inspire oneself, she added, “But then I realised I had to pull myself out of this for my children. But then I realised again that that wasn’t quite right either—I had to pull myself out of it for my relationship with Dustin. I had to pull myself out of it for me.”

Talking to the magazine, Paulina said, “Growing up in the family I did, I was constantly surrounded by sports, but we’re not hard on ourselves. The lesson is always to do the best you can and have fun.” Expressing her love for being physically fit and active, she also shared wonderful advice with the magazine.

“You do what you can with the environment that you’re given and so even if I’m just walking on a golf course, everything is about staying active: start small, set little goals, and try to build healthy habits for consistency over time,” said the 34-year-old model.
